😐Monthly costs for one person with rent: $1,365 in Csongrad versus $1,261 in Phuket.
😐Estimated couple costs with rent: $2,110 in Csongrad versus $2,078 in Phuket.
🙂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$2,854 in Csongrad versus $2,896 in Phuket.
🌍Living in Csongrad is roughly 8% more expensive than in Phuket, driven mainly by Eating Out.

🏠A one-bedroom apartment in the center runs $542 in Csongrad and $756 in Phuket. Housing cost is often the main lever when comparing two cities.
🛒Dining out: $60.0 in Csongrad vs $35.00 in Phuket for a mid-range dinner for two. Groceries echo the gap at $274 vs $272 per month, with Phuket cheaper across the board.

What is the total cost difference between living in Csongrad and in Phuket?
Csongrad and Phuket differ by about 8% in total monthly costs ($1,365 vs $1,261 including rent). Phuket is meaningfully more affordable – a gap that matters a lot on a fixed or modest income.
What salary covers living expenses in Csongrad compared to Phuket?
You'd need roughly $2,048 in Csongrad and $1,891 in Phuket to live well. The gap comes down to housing and overall price levels. Both cities are liveable on less, but these numbers represent actual comfort.
How do apartment prices compare in Csongrad and in Phuket?
Rent for a central apartment: $542 in Csongrad versus $756 in Phuket. Housing is usually the single largest factor when comparing overall living costs between the two.
